Types of Roulette Bets
Comprehending the various types of wagers in roulette is crucial for players looking to maximize their gaming experience. Roulette provides a wide variety of betting options, which can be broadly categorized into inside and outside bets.
Inside bets are made on specific numbers or small groups of numbers, offering greater returns but lower odds. Common inside bets consist of a straight-up bet on a one number, split bets on two adjacent numbers, and corner bets covering four numbers.
Outside wagers, alternatively, offer enhanced odds but minimal payouts. These wagers include options such as red or black, odd or even, and high or low numbers.
Additionally, players can engage in dozen and column wagers, which span a series of 12 numbers. Grasping these wager varieties permits bettors to formulate plans suited to their appetite for risk and sought winnings, enhancing their overall roulette session.

Implement a Strategy
Understanding a wide variety of betting options establishes the basis for putting into action powerful strategies that can boost a player's odds at roulette. One widely used approach is the Martingale strategy, which requires increasing stakes after every loss, working to recoup previous losses through a one victory. On the other hand, the Fibonacci strategy uses a sequence of numbers to set bet sizes, fostering a more prudent approach. Players should also evaluate the D'Alembert system, which adjusts bets based on wins and losses. Any strategy requires thoughtful assessment of table limits and individual willingness to risk. In the end, although no strategy assures success, implementing a systematic approach can improve the overall gaming experience and potentially raise the likelihood of winning.

What Are the Odds of Hitting a Single Number?
The likelihood of striking a single number in roulette are 1 in 37 for European wheels and 1 in 38 for American wheels. This illustrates the total number of possible outcomes on the wheel.
Can You Discover Any Betting Systems That Certify Wins?
No betting systems pledge wins in roulette, as the entertainment relies on probability. Plans like Martingale may refine player experience, but they cannot defeat the mathematical advantage, verifying long-term losses outweigh temporary profits.
